If the UE performance is indeed the main concern for you, rest assured. DF claim that this is probably one of the best games in terms of performance made with UE5:



Small environments and natural enhancements on UE5 over time.



-----------



- DF saw base PS5 and PC version
- Base PS5 version's game-play was "smooth" 60 and cut-scenes locked to 30.

- DF noted minor issues with PC version but noted in the settings that it was running at native 4K.
- John changed settings to DLSS Quality and said he saw no issues with performance afterward.

- DF noted no stutter, hitching etc during their time
- Noted some Software Lumen for indirect lighting and SSR for reflections (console)
- The wording isn't clear but John sounds like he noted Lumen reflections only on the PC version (he didn't mention it for PS5)

- Seems like they're shipping a very solid UE5 game without any of the usual UE5 caveats
